Highlights
Are people in Marshville older or younger than people in Asheville?
- The Median Age in Marshville is 6.2 years younger than in Asheville.

Are housing costs cheaper in Marshville or Asheville?
- Marshville housing costs are 41.9% less expensive than Asheville hous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Marshville or Asheville?
- The average commute for residents of Marshville is 12.3 minutes longer than it is for residents of Asheville.

Things to do in Asheville?
Asheville, North Carolina is a vibrant city in the Blue Ridge Mountains. Here, you can explore natural landscapes like the Pisgah National Forest or visit popular attractions such as the Biltmore Estate and the River Arts District. When it comes to nightlife, Asheville has a wide range of bars, breweries and music venues for visitors to enjoy. It's also home to some impressive art galleries and museums – perfect for indulging your creative side! With its many outdoor activities and cultural opportunities, Asheville is an ideal destination for adventure seekers and culture lovers alike.

 Asheville, NCMarshville, NCUnited States
 Population93,2722,533329,725,481
 Median Income$58,193$44,861$69,021
 Median Age40.334.138.4
 Avg. Home Price$428,500$248,900$338,100
 Unemployment Rate4.5%3.7%6.0%
 Avg. Commute Time17.8130.1426.38
